    Abstract: A sensor assembly includes a frame defining a sensor axis having opposing endplates with axially extending supports, wherein the opposing endplates are connected by a pair of axially extending side beams. A suspended mass is within an interior of the frame suspended from the supports of the frame. A plurality of spacers are operatively connected to the endplates and supports of the frame. A plurality of piezoelectric material layers are operatively connected to sides of respective spacers opposite the frame to damp vibrations.

    Abstract: A method for performing test site synchronization within automated test equipment (ATE) is presented. The method comprises controlling a plurality of test program controllers (TPCs) using a plurality of bridge controllers (BCs), wherein each TPC can initiate multiple asynchronous events. For an asynchronous event initiated by a TPC, raising a busy flag while the asynchronous event is not yet complete and de-asserting the busy flag when the asynchronous event is complete, wherein the asynchronous event corresponds to a task requiring an indeterminate amount of time. It also comprises generating a busy signal in the first BCs in response to receiving a busy flag from any of the plurality of TPCs, wherein the busy signal remains asserted while any of the plurality of TPCs asserts a busy flag. Finally, it comprises transmitting the busy signal to the plurality of TPCs, wherein the TPCs use the busy signal to synchronize operations.

    Abstract: Compositions and methods are provided for the diagnosis, treatment, and medical management of cancers. The methods include the use of antibodies and other binding molecules that specifically bind to one or more nucleotide salvage pathway enzymes (SPEs) selected from the group consisting of adenine phosphoribosyltransferase (APRT), hypoxanthine-guanine phosphoribosyltransferase (HGPRT), deoxycytidine kinase (dCK); and thymidine kinase 1 (TK1) and complexes comprising SPEs, for detection of the SPE(s) on or in cancer cells and/or on or in body fluids and tissues of cancer patients. Binding of SPEs is useful in the methods provided herein for diagnosing cancer, determining prognosis of cancer and assessing the effectiveness of cancer treatments. Immunoassay systems for use in the methods are also provided, including sandwich immunoassays. In addition, an amino acid sequence comprising a novel TK1 binding site is provided, as well as nucleotide sequences encoding it.

    Abstract: A face insert comprising a planar member composed of a rigid material such as plastic or metal and a polymeric backing is disclosed herein. The planar member, which makes contact with a golf ball during use, includes a plurality of geometrically-shaped holes, each of which comprises a perimeter edge that has a variable radius to further optimize performance of the face insert. In some embodiments, one or more of the holes extends completely through the planar member, i.e. is a through-hole, and the polymeric backing includes at least one protrusion with an angled upper surface that is sized to extend into a through-hole and further improve performance of the face insert. The face insert described herein can be used with any type of golf club head, including putters, woods, irons, and hybrids, and the holes may take any shape, including oval, hexagonal, and chevron.
